Dear Visitors, dear Exhibitors,

After only two decades the ADIBF is now the most professional book fair in the region and one of the world’s fastest-growing publishing events.

In 2011:

- The cultural programme, as diverse and international as the population of    the UAE, will give all booklovers a reason to attend the show.
- The Show Kitchen will again delight foodies with the culinary creations of    international and local chefs. In 2011 the cultural focus is on France,    ensuring a tantalising feast for your taste buds on March 16 with “Un Jour    en France”.
- Children will experience the joy of reading through edutaining activities at    the Creativity Corner (CC).
- If you seek information on digital publishing, the eZone offers the general    public and the professional visitor more ‘techie’ options.
- Speaking of professional: this year we are offering exhibitors a professional    programme that will help them make contacts in the MENA region and    beyond, and that provides insight on industry trends, children’s books,    illustrations, translation rights—and this year’s Market Focus: Korea!
- The Education Chapter (TEC3), for teachers and publishers, is all about    learning, and how to purchase and produce the best educational materials.
- One other unique ADIBF offer is a programme subsidising translation deals    that happen at the fair: Spotlight on Rights!
